Diversity Schoolhouse
  Knowledge Leads to Respect

This In-Service Training is for Social Service Workers, Teachers, Therapists, Youth Leaders, and Home Visitors.  Diversity Schoolhouse is designed to help frontline workers within the social services field improve their communication with and understanding of the various ethnic, cultural, religious and other socially diverse groups in our community.  Presenters are often parents and community members who provide insight to service providers and share their unique stories.

All Diversity Schoolhouse sessions will be held on the 4th Wednesday of each month throughout the school year with a few noted exceptions.  Please note:  School's out for the summer and the month of December.

Sessions run from 12 noon until 1 pm unless otherwise noted. 
You are encouraged to bring your lunch to these sessions.

There is no cost for Diversity Schoolhouse and pre-registration is not required.
